113
114 /*!
115 @brief
116 \bt_name boolean type.
117
118 The API uses #bt_bool instead of the C99 \c bool type for
119 <a href="https://en.wikipedia.org/wiki/Application_binary_interface">application binary interface</a>
120 reasons.
121
122 Use #BT_TRUE and #BT_FALSE to set and compare #bt_bool variables.
123 */
124 typedef int bt_bool;
125
126 /*!
127 @brief
128 Numeric ID which identifies a user listener function.
129
130 Some functions, such as bt_trace_add_destruction_listener(), return a
131 listener ID when you add a user listener function to some object. You
132 can then use this listener ID to remove the listener from the object.
133 */
134 typedef uint64_t bt_listener_id;
135
136 /*!
137 @brief
138 A
139 <a href="https://en.wikipedia.org/wiki/Universally_unique_identifier">UUID</a>,
140 that is, an array of 16&nbsp;constant bytes.
141 */
142 typedef uint8_t const *bt_uuid;
143
144 /*!
145 @brief
146 Availability of an object's property.
147
148 Some getter functions of the API, such as
149 bt_event_class_get_log_level(), return, by output parameter, an optional
150 object property which is not a pointer. In that case, the function
151 either:
152
153 - Returns #BT_PROPERTY_AVAILABILITY_AVAILABLE and sets an output
154 parameter to the property's value.
155 - Returns #BT_PROPERTY_AVAILABILITY_NOT_AVAILABLE.
156 */
157 typedef enum bt_property_availability {
158 /*!
159 @brief
160 Property is available.
161 */
162 BT_PROPERTY_AVAILABILITY_AVAILABLE = 1,
163
164 /*!
165 @brief
166 Property is not available.
167 */
168 BT_PROPERTY_AVAILABILITY_NOT_AVAILABLE = 0,
169 } bt_property_availability;
170
171 /*!
172 @brief
173 Array of constant \bt_p_msg.
174
175 Such an array is filled by the
176 \link api-msg-iter-cls-meth-next "next" method\endlink of a
177 \bt_msg_iter and consumed with bt_message_iterator_next() by another
178 message iterator or by a \bt_sink_comp.
179 */
180 typedef bt_message const **bt_message_array_const;
